My World Poem by Eddie Armstrong

My World



I live in a world where normal is something abnormal
to have no elegance in this world seems to be something formal
Those of us in this world all live in our own dark abyss
and those in the real world look down at us in a world like this
Most don't know the difference or act like they don't care
about the path that we follow that is leading us nowhere
We will pretend or act like if everything was just fine
and our priorities then become lost as the same does our time
We never even noticed we went past the point of no return
now to change what we're used to is something new we have to learn
In the beginning it was all just fun and games
now our youth is spent and we are no longer the same
those of us in this world all have one thing in which we can relate
its that personal issue we avoid which makes us al the same
I'm alone in this world with strange people all around
except i wear a huge smile that is always turned upside down
i hope one day the criticism that fuels my own agony
finally reaches the end and I'm accepted for who i chose to be

POET'S NOTES ABOUT THE POEM
when i wrote this poem i was feeling alone amongst people that i really didn't know. What inspired me to write this was when i saw to great people with so much talent walk in, except they are what we call chemical dependent individuals. Realizing where i was at that precise moment and remembering when i was a child hearing stories or trying to imagine people who are in that world and what they were doing. So what i saw was that they had no worries in the world and lived life expressing happiness but really just making the best of every situation they are in. I did notice one thing from asking questions that we all have one thing that pushed most of us into this world. It was someone we love putting us down or us never satisfying them in some way. I was able to relate to them
